What is the market's #1 secret? After 20 years of investing through bubbles and crashes, I believe I've finally figured it out. It has little to do with picking "hot stocks" and everything to do with understanding what the financial news doesn't tell you. In this deep-dive conversation on "The Expert Seat" Podcast hosted by Kristen Tilgner at OnPod Studio, I pull back the curtain on the lessons that have fundamentally changed my approach to the market. We cover everything from "portfolio insurance" and the flaws of the 60/40 model to the psychology that separates winning investors from the crowd. Ultimately, you'll see how these pieces connect to reveal the one "secret" that provides true peace of mind.
